KLA logo

Software Engineer (E)

KLA

Ann Arbor, MI
Full Time
Entry Level
78k-132k
2 days ago

Job Description

About the Role

KL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. The company focuses on innovation, investing 15% of sales back into R&D, and works with the world's leading technology providers to advance electronic device manufacturing. Life at KLA is dynamic and challenging, with teams dedicated to tackling complex problems in a collaborative environment.

Key Responsibilities

  • Building and maintaining infrastructure vital for large-scale experimentation and deployment of HPC solutions.
  • Prototyping and developing machine control and business logic solutions to build next-generation products.
  • Contributing to data management and data loading, supporting machine learning and deep learning model training.

Requirements

  • Master's Degree with 0 years related work experience or Bachelor's Degree with 2 years related work experience.
  • Outstanding skills and hands-on experience with development in C/C++ and Python in a Windows/Linux environment.
  • Deep conceptual understanding of multi-threaded, multi-process, and distributed software systems.
  • Experience in object-oriented programming or object-oriented design.
  • Good oral and written communication skills to interact with other engineers.

Nice to Have

  • Familiarity with Machine Learning and Deep Learning solutions.

Qualifications

  • Master's Degree or Bachelor's Degree with related work experience.

Benefits & Perks

  • Medical, dental, vision, and life insurance.
  • Voluntary benefits and 401(K) with company matching.
  • Employee stock purchase program (ESPP).
  • Student debt assistance and tuition reimbursement.
  • Development and career growth opportunities.
  • Financial planning benefits.
  • Wellness benefits including employee assistance program (EAP).
  • Paid time off and holidays.
  • Family care and bonding leave.

Working at KLA

KLA values innovation, collaboration, and tackling challenging problems. The company invests heavily in R&D and fosters a dynamic environment where teams thrive on solving complex technical issues and advancing technology in the semiconductor industry.

Apply Now

Job Details

Posted AtAug 13, 2025
Salary78k-132k
Job TypeFull Time
ExperienceEntry Level

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About KLA

Website

kla.com

Company Size

5001-10000 employees

Location

Ann Arbor, MI

Industry

Navigational, Measuring, Electromedical, and Control Instruments Manufacturing

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ches